Wrestling season is back and the Leyden Wrestling team is now at an overall record of 4 and 6.

Head coach Mike Fummagalli seems to be very satisfied with his team’s progress this year.

“We were 7-11 last year and had a lot of difficulties with kids focusing, this year everyone’s focused. I think we will have great potential.”

He mentioned that one of the team’s biggest achievements this year was “beating Morton who was undefeated… that was our goal since day one.”

As he continues to help wrestlers stay focused he noted how his strategies differ noting that “it could be motivating kids one day or telling a kid to push harder because he’s being too soft another.”

Captain Dominick Miro agreed that it’s a big year and “we have a lot of great talent, [and] state positions are going to be all up for grabs.”

Some wrestlers who have already begun to stand out include “Anthony Lonigro and Ryan Soch [who] have been working hard, they deserve the best.”

Senior night will be Saturday, January 30, when the guys take on the Hinsdale South Hornets.
